Abstract:Objective To explore the distribution of microRNA-208 rs10136106 polymorphism in Guangxi people and to compare the distribution with that of people in other regions, and further to investigate the correlation between rs10136106 polymorphism and the levels of blood lipids.Methods A total of 168 unrelated healthy individuals undergoing health checkup in Affiliated Hospital of Guilin Medical University from January 2021 to June 2021 were enrolled. The high-throughput SNPscan technology was used to determine the genotyping of rs10136106. The blood lipid profiles in all individuals were collected, and the differences among them were analyzed.Results Two genotypes, AG (3.57%) and GG (96.43%), were found at the rs10136106 locus, and the frequencies of A and G alleles were 1.79% and 98.21%. There was no significant difference in the genotype frequency and allele frequency at the rs10136106 locus between males and females among the Guangxi people (P > 0.05). The genotype frequency and allele frequency at the rs10136106 locus in the Guangxi people differed from those in the Utah people, Yoruba people, and Tuscany people (P < 0.05), while they were not different from those in the Tokyo people and Han people from Beijing (P > 0.05). There was no difference in the levels of triglyceride, high density lipoprotein cholesterol or low density lipoprotein cholesterol between AG and GG carriers (P > 0.05), whereas the level of total cholesterol in AG carriers was lower than that in GG carriers (P < 0.05).Conclusions There are different degrees of variation in the microRNA-208 rs10136106 polymorphism among Guangxi people and those from other regions. Besides, the rs10136106 polymorphism is related to the level of total cholesterol.
